The case study was carried out with the help of satellite technologies for the spatial positioning of the various characteristic points of detail in the town of Suiug, Bihor county, and has as its objective the spatial positioning of the points of detail with the GPS system, through the post-processing kinematic method (pseudokinematics) Stop and Go, for the realization of the topographic plans in digital format, and respectively, of the digital models of the land, necessary for the rehabilitation and expansion of the roads in the locality. Trimble R3 receivers were used as base, and Trimble R4 as rover. When recording data from the field, we worked with the Trimble Digital Fieldbook and Trimble Access programs, and the processing with the Trimble Total Control (TTC) program. The coordinates of the base and initialization points of the rover were determined with the Trimble R4 receiver, with information acquired from the Oradea GNSS station, within the ROMPOS system. Mapsys 10.0 and Surfer programs were used to obtain the plan and land model in digital format.
